Weight is the measure of the force of gravity acting on an object. Mass is a measure of the amount of matter in an object. Weight depends on both the mass of the object and the acceleration due to gravity.

The measure of how hard gravity pulls on an object is its weight. Weight is the force exerted on an object due to gravity and is usually expressed in units such as pounds or newtons. It is proportional to the mass of the object and the acceleration due to gravity.
